Head to head
Ranks are only compared within one published list and one year. Two ranks from different years, from a boys' and a girls' list, or from different registrars are not comparable, so they are not placed side by side.
England and Wales · Boys
In 2025, Albie was ranked #21 and Haris #340 among boys in England and Wales.
Scotland · Boys
In 2024, Albie was ranked #32 and Haris #478 among boys in Scotland.
Republic of Ireland · Boys
In 2025, Albie was ranked #179 and Haris #509 among boys in Republic of Ireland.
England and Wales · Girls
In 2017, Albie was ranked #4063 and Haris #5765 among girls in England and Wales.

List by list
England and Wales · Boys30 shared years, 1996–2025
Albie held the stronger position in 17 of those years, Haris in 13.
Highest recorded here: Albie #19 in 2024, Haris #261 in 2007.
The order changed in 2009: Albie moved ahead. In 2008 they stood at #341 and #302; by 2009 that had become #291 and #302.
Most recent shared year, 2025: Albie #21, Haris #340.
Republic of Ireland · Boys9 shared years, 2016–2025
Albie held the stronger position in 8 of those years, Haris in 0.
Highest recorded here: Albie #179 in 2025, Haris #495 in 2017.
The order changed in 2017: Albie moved ahead. In 2016 they stood at #601 and #601; by 2017 that had become #336 and #495.
Most recent shared year, 2025: Albie #179, Haris #509.
